基于Google距离的语义Web服务发现技术研究

来源 :北京工业大学 | 被引量 : 0次 | 上传用户:qnmdmmm
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
Web服务是一种新兴的Web应用方式,是一个崭新的分布式对象模型,近年来得到了迅速的发展。随着其应用范围以及Web服务动态组合需求的扩大,Web服务的发布与发现,已经成为Web服务系统架构中的一个关键技术。  传统的Web服务,其发布与发现通过UDDI服务注册中心实现。由于UDDI注册中心只能提供基于关键字的查询,缺乏对语义信息的支持,使得服务匹配是基于关键字和语法级的匹配,不能实现基于服务功能的语义匹配,从而造成服务查准率和查全率较低。语义Web服务的出现,使得Web服务的描述能力大大提高,Web服务发现过程转变成了基于语义的服务匹配,为更加准确全面地进行Web服务的发现提供了语义支持。  本文主要研究基于Google距离的语义Web服务发现问题。首先阐述了该课题的研究背景以及国内外的研究现状,介绍了语义Web服务的相关技术和词汇之间语义信息距离的相关概念。然后本文重点介绍了语义Web服务发现所使用的匹配算法,该算法利用基于Google距离的概念间相似度度量方法,通过计算服务输入输出参数的相似度,使用sigmoid阈值函数求得输入输出各自的权值,通过加权求和来计算输入输出总体相似度,从而求得服务匹配度。对比其它算法,本文算法充分利用了Google所提供的大规模的语料库和开放的搜索引擎,不仅能够反映概念随着Web不断更新的语义信息,又避免了领域本体树算法对概念在特定的领域本体库的限制。输入输出总体相似度的计算实现了权值与各个相似度的自适应,提高了匹配的准确性。基于Google距离的语义Web服务匹配算法量化了服务匹配相似度,发挥了Google大规模语料库和Google搜索引擎的优势,避免了领域本体树算法匹配过程中的种种限制,提高了Web服务发现过程中的查准率和查全率。最后,给出了语义Web服务发现原型系统的层次结构设计,利用基于Google距离进行的服务匹配流程的设计,并就语义Web服务发现原型系统进行了实现,在其基础上进行了实验测试,取得了预期的效果。
其他文献
如何在互联网的海量信息中找到自己所需要的信息已经成为困扰人们的主要问题。元搜索引擎可以综合多个搜索引擎的查询结果,因而提高了搜索的覆盖率,但同时也带来了一些问题。元
全过程计算机辅助动画自动生成技术是将人工智能理论引入到动画制作领域而产生的技术,20世纪90年代由中科院陆汝钤院士提出。全过程计算机辅助手机3D动画自动生成系统(简称手
随着PaaS逐步兴起,以及DevOps和自动化运维的快速发展,基于Docker的容器虚拟化环境成为业务系统的主流部署运行环境之一。Docker生态体系仍然面临着诸多挑战,其中容器镜像的构建
近年来,互联网和移动通信技术得到快速发展与广泛普及,越来越多的虚拟社会形态相继出现,比如以Facebook,Twitter,新浪微博等为代表的大型在线社交网络网站,通过手机通信、电子邮件
当前临床医生进行疾病诊治的主要方法是依靠自身的专业知识和诊疗经验,并借助医学检查器械进行辅助检查,缺少有效的辅助方法。一名专业的临床医生往往要经过长时间的知识储备和
随着信息技术的不断发展和计算机网络的广泛普及,使得人们对信息安全的重视越来越高。而目前针对信息的保护主要基于系统的安全和网络的安全。本文主要是针对系统设计的安全进
为了解决传统BIOS所面临的问题,Intel推出了统一可扩展固件接口(UEFI)的规范标准,定义了操作系统与平台固件之间的可扩展接口。目前,UEFI BIOS凭借自身的模块化、易扩展、预启动
深层神经网络是一种高变度的函数(highly-varying function),与许多经典的浅层结构算法相比,以深层神经网络为代表的深层结构有很多优点,近年来引起了极大的关注,并且在逐步在分
学位
随着信息与网络技术的快速发展,大数据已经影响到每一个行业。大数据的价值在于从各种类型的数据中快速获取有用的信息,而数据预处理是整个大数据处理周期中至关重要的环节,高质